Output 2725aaf9583a22d4ad78cd133fe1ab3f1a53315c74991851367df487d6e689eb:0

value
907688118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ff0a4632e534148a58df77680ebd835ca0603602 OP_EQUAL
address
3QwYYKpyHdEHgVHm6DYC1uQwXAXXCboRkh
transaction
2725aaf9583a22d4ad78cd133fe1ab3f1a53315c74991851367df487d6e689eb
spent
true